1. Split or Broken Glass
Service:
DIY Repair: For minor cracks, property owners can utilize a glass repair kit. However, for larger breaks, it's suggested to contact an expert.Change the Pane: If the damage is substantial, replacing the whole pane may be needed, which includes removing the broken glass and replacing it with a brand-new one.2. Drafts and Poor Insulation
Option:
Weatherstripping: Adding weatherstripping around windows can considerably lower drafts. This is a cost-efficient method to enhance insulation.Window Film: Applying window movie can improve insulation without substantial renovations.3. Sticking or Difficult-to-Open Windows
Solution:
Lubrication: Use a silicone spray lube on the tracks and hinges to relieve movement.Realignment: Sometimes, the window might be misaligned, which can be corrected by adjusting the installation or hinges.4. Dripping Windows
Service:
Caulking: Inspect the existing caulking for cracks or separations. Reapply caulk around the window frame to prevent leakages.Flashing Repair: If water is getting in due to improper flashing, repairs may be essential to reroute water far from the window.5. Frame Damage
Service:
Patching: Minor rot and damage to wood frames can typically be patched.Replacement: In cases where the damage is serious, replacement of the entire window frame might be needed.6. Foggy Windows
Solution:
Defogging: Professional services can often "defog" double or triple-pane windows to bring back clearness.Pane Replacement: If defogging isn't efficient, changing the whole window might be the very best service.When to Call a Professional

1. How can I inform if my window requires repairs?
Look for drafts, condensation between panes, cracks in the glass, or difficulty opening and closing.
2. Can I repair a split window myself?
Small cracks can be fixed with DIY glass packages, but bigger breaks normally need professional support.
3. What is the typical cost of window repair?
Expenses vary extensively based on the type of window and extent of damage, but general repairs can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 400.
4. How typically should I inspect my windows?
It's suggested to inspect your windows a minimum of as soon as a year, especially before and after harsh weather seasons.
5. Can I prevent window issues?
Regular maintenance, such as cleaning up the frames, looking for fractures, and re-caulking, can help prevent many window concerns.
